Celebrating First Holy Communion 2022
Information Evening
Fr Sam Lynch welcomes all parents of first Holy Communion candidates for 2022 to attend a parent information session and Mass. It will be held Sunday 18 September in St Michael's Church at 5pm and followed by Mass at 6pm. As the program requirements have changed this year we advise all parents to attend.
Please note the children of St Michael's Parish celebrate their first Holy Communion in year 3 or above. They are required to have been baptised in the Catholic faith and to have received their First Reconciliation. If your child is baptised Catholic but is yet to receive their First Reconciliation please enroll them in our First Reconciliation program that runs in Term 3 and attend the First Reconciliation Parent information session to be held on Sunday 24 July. Program details are found under the First Reconciliation heading on the Sacrament menu.
First Communion Mass Dates
We are pleased to celebrate First Holy Communion over two Masses in 2022. Mass dates are Sunday 6th November or Sunday 13 November at 11.30am. Mass dates are subject to availability and any prevailing government restrictions for COVID safety requirements.
Presentation Masses
Candidates will attend Mass after their sacrament lessons on Saturday or Sunday evenings, where the will be presented to the parish community.
Lesson Preparation
Candidates from St Michael's Primary in year 3 will prepare for their first Communion during class lesson time.
All candidates from state and independent schools and St Michael's students in year 4 and above are required to attend 3 x 50 minute lessons followed by Mass at 6pm. The sacrament program is taught by Mrs Lolina Aljasin our Sacramental Teacher. Lessons will be held in the church hall and full attendance is required for lessons and Mass. Lesson 1 commences on 15 or 16 October at 5pm. You will be asked to indicate your lesson and Mass choice on the online booking sheet.
Mass Rehearsals
Mass rehearsals will take place for all candidates on Wednesday 2 November 2022. First Communion Mass 1 bookings attend Mass 1 rehearsal at 4.00pm and First Communion Mass 2 attend their rehearsal at 5.30pm. Candidates must attend the rehearsal time that corresponds to their first Communion Mass selection. Please take this into consideration when booking your child's First Communion Mass date as rehearsal attendance is mandatory. All state and independent school candidates will make their reconciliation between 5.00-5.30pm on the rehearsal afternoon.
Enrolments
Children who received their First Reconciliation at St Michael's in 2021 are automatically enrolled for their First Communion sacrament in 2022. They are not required to enrol again. They will be sent an email requesting they indicate their lesson dates and Mass selection. If you have changed your email address or family details since July 2021 please send through your new contact details to the parish office.
Enrolment for candidates who wish to celebrate their First Holy Communion at St Michael's who have previously made their First Reconciliation at another parish will need to complete an enrolment form and attach their baptism certificate. New enrolments for First Communion Sacramental Program will open 19 September following the information session for parents. Enrolments will close 12 October at C.O.B..
